<p>If you attend HS in the US, you will be evaluated against all US HS applicants, no matter your citizenship. If you are a Canadian citizen, I think you’ll get Canadian tuition rate. They admit by straight forward cut offs for SATs and GPAs, and it varies by program; practically no essays or credit for ECs. I never heard there is any regard for minority status in admissions either. Your scores should be fine, but it’s a good idea to apply to at least 2 programs to give yourself a better chance, esp. if something becomes highly popular next year.
